Butuan – There has nothing to fear against possible A(H1N1) spread in Davao, this after a 4 year old boy from Butuan City was confined in Davao Medical Center.
Davao Medical Center Chief Dr. Leopoldo Vega briefed the local media that the hospital do not have the reason to refuse the first A(H1N1) patient in Mindanao, being the choice of the grandmother of the 4 year old boy instead of complying with DOH Caraga’s health protocol that all confirmed patients in the region will be confined at Caraga Regional Hospital in Surigao City, although it was emphasized that the patient has DOH-Caraga Regional Director’s referral.
The 4 year old boy including his grandmother, a 9 year old girl who had close contact with the patient who is exhibiting flu like symptoms and the girl’s parents are now at the isolation ward of Davao Medical Center, situated away from the main building.
While the ambulance driver who transport the patient from Butuan to Davao and the accompanying health personnel followed directives in handling cases as this by wearing proper protective gear.
According to Dr. Vega following the routine protocol there is no chance of spreading the virus.
He assured the public that nurses and medical personnel at the isolation ward of Davao Medical Center are equipped with protective gears and these are properly disposed of after use and strictly observed washing of hands thoroughly and constantly reminded to practice good hygiene before leaving the isolation ward.
The quarantine and treatment of said patients will last 5-7 days until such time throat swab tests yielded negative results for A(H1N1) from the Research Institute for Tropical Medicine of the Department of Health.
The boy had just come from Hongkong, where he was accompanied by his grandmother to visit his parents who are working there when he developed fever few days after arriving in Butuan on June 13 and was confirmed with A(H1N1) on June 19. (photo by Edgar Arro)
